IN THE CIRCUIT COURT OF       COUNTY, MISSISSIPPI       PLAINTIFF VS. NO.             DEFENDANT COMPLAINT COMES NOW       and for cause of action against       alleges as follows: I. Plaintiff       is an adult resident citizen of       County, Mississippi, and resides at       ,       ,       County, Mississippi. II. Defendant is a Mississippi Corporation and has as its registered agent for service of process       who may be served with process at       ,       ,       County, Mississippi       . III. Plaintiff       alleges that on or about             ,       , he/she was exiting the       on       ,       , Mississippi. Said building is owned, occupied and managed by Defendant. As Plaintiff stepped down from the concrete steps in front of said building, he/she caught the heel of his/her shoe in a crack in the concrete, causing his/her to fall and sustain serious, painful and permanent injuries as hereinafter described. Said crack was higher on one side than the other side, which was deceptive in appearance, and the uneven height contributed to the cause of Plaintiff's fall. IV.       a.       b. Negligent failure to warn individuals such as Plaintiff of the hazardous and dangerous condition which then and there existed, which was known or should have been known by defendant. c. Failure to maintain the steps in a reasonably safe condition; d. Failure to provide a handrail, e. Other acts of negligence to be shown at trial, which may be learned through discovery. VI. Plaintiff       alleges that as a result of the negligence of the Defendant, and the aforesaid accident, the Plaintiff sustained a       , and as a result thereof had to have surgery and a steel       inserted. Medical bills thus far have exceeded $       . Plaintiff has had to endure grievous pain and suffering as a result of his/her injury, continues to suffer with his/her injury at this time, and reasonably believes that he/she will suffer permanently from his/her injuries. In addition, Plaintiff reasonably believes that he/she will require medical treatment in the future for the treatment of said injuries. Plaintiff has suffered permanent disability as a result of his/her injuries, and will never enjoy the health he/she enjoyed prior to the subject accident. All such damages are as a result of the negligence of Defendant. VII. Plaintiff alleges that the negligent acts of the Defendant were the proximate cause or the proximate contributing cause of the Plaintiff's accident and injuries. WHEREFORE, PREMISES CONSIDERED, Plaintiff sues and demands judgment of and from       in the amount of $       . Respectfully submitted, _______________________________________       Attorney for       Of counsel:                         Telephone:       MSB #       Attorney for
